The Mathematical Symphony of Artificial Neurons

At their core, neural networks are inspired by biological neural structures. Each artificial neuron functions as a sophisticated mathematical transformer, processing input signals and generating nuanced outputs. The magic happens in how these neurons interconnect and learn from experience.

[f(x) = \frac{1}{1 + e^{-x}}]

This sigmoid activation function represents a fundamental mechanism through which neurons make decisions, transforming linear inputs into non-linear representations.

Keras: Democratizing Deep Learning

Keras stands as a testament to the philosophy of making complex technologies accessible. Developed by François Chollet, this Python library simplifies neural network development without compromising computational sophistication.

Why Keras Matters

Traditional machine learning frameworks often required extensive low-level programming. Keras revolutionized this approach by providing:

  • Intuitive API design
  • Modular architecture
  • Seamless backend integration
  • Rapid prototyping capabilities

Data Preparation: The Foundation of Intelligent Models

import numpy as np
import pandas as pd
from sklearn.preprocessing import StandardScaler
from sklearn.model_selection import train_test_split
from keras.models import Sequential
from keras.layers import Dense, Dropout

# Advanced data preprocessing
def prepare_dataset(data, target_column):
    X = data.drop(target_column, axis=1)
    y = data[target_column]

    # Sophisticated scaling
    scaler = StandardScaler()
    X_scaled = scaler.fit_transform(X)

    return train_test_split(X_scaled, y, test_size=0.2, random_state=42)

Architectural Design: Crafting Intelligent Layers

def create_advanced_model(input_shape):
    model = Sequential([
        Dense(64, activation=‘relu‘, input_shape=(input_shape,), 
              kernel_regularizer=l2(0.001)),
        BatchNormalization(),
        Dropout(0.3),
        Dense(32, activation=‘relu‘, 
              kernel_regularizer=l2(0.001)),
        BatchNormalization(),
        Dropout(0.2),
        Dense(1, activation=‘sigmoid‘)
    ])

    model.compile(
        optimizer=Adam(learning_rate=0.001),
        loss=‘binary_crossentropy‘,
        metrics=[‘accuracy‘]
    )

    return model
